... Read moreAs someone stepping into the world of nursing, I completely understand the anxiety that comes with dosage calculations. It’s not just about math; it’s about ensuring patient safety and accuracy. One thing I’ve learned from my early practice is that approaching dosage calculations with dimensional analysis makes the entire process more manageable. Instead of memorizing formulas blindly, I focus on breaking down each problem to understand what units I’m working with and how they convert. This method helped me catch errors before finalizing answers—because an impossible dose could risk a patient's life. Another tip from my experience is to start practicing dosage problems well before clinical rotations begin. Waiting until the last minute only adds to the stress. I found that watching breakdowns from experienced nurses like A Blessed RN helped me see the why behind each step, which is critical for retention. Importantly, dosage calculations are directly tied to patient care, so accuracy is paramount. I always remind myself to double-check units, doses, and conversion factors. When in doubt, I pause and review rather than rush to an answer. If you’re struggling with similar fears, consider sharing your challenges and successes with fellow nursing students. It’s encouraging to know you’re not alone. Tackling dosage calculations early with patience and the right strategies can turn your fear into confidence—and that’s a vital skill for any nursing journey.
